WebSep 22, 2024 · If a shortcut to the program whose EXE you want to find isn’t easily available, you can browse C:\Program Files or C:\Program Files (x86) on your machine to find the … WebAug 19, 2024 · Program Files is a protected folder. Program Files is also special in that, if you are running a 32-bit or 64-bit version of Windows, what the application sees is identical. In other words, when dealing with a 32-bit application, Program Files (x86) will appear to be Program Files on a 64-bit version of Windows.

In summary, on a 32-bit version of Windows, you just have a “C:\Program Files” folder. This contains all your installed programs, all of which are 32-bit. On a 64-bit version of Windows, 64-bit programs are stored in the “C:\Program Files” folder and 32-bit programs are stored in the “C:\Program Files (x86)” folder.
